I've never used that and probably never will. I drove a manual Subaru before my X3 and using manual mode on the X3 and downshifting gives you plenty of control. That hill looks far less sketchy than the back alley I have to skate down every day and I take mine at 10-15mph (speed limit is 15mph).

She is ready for ice skating … 🥶 by Giannoza in BMWX3

[–]renegadepsoun 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Also - stop riding the brake, on ice, that is a recipe for sketchiness. In manual mode, simply engine brake and feather the brake pedal as needed.

She is ready for ice skating … 🥶 by Giannoza in BMWX3

[–]renegadepsoun 1 point2 points  (0 children)

How slow are you going? With decent tires (Cross Climate 2's come to mind if you don't want/need dedicated winters) and using manual mode (M1 or M2) you shouldnt need to crawl at 0.5 mph. That doesn't mean you can or should bomb the hill stupidly, but xDrive will have your back at prudent speeds. I have the same issues atm with winter where I am at and it does fine!
